Exactly What is Royalty-Free Music?

Royalty-free music is a type of music licensing that allows creators to utilize a track several times without paying additional costs. When you've obtained the license, you can utilize the music in several tasks, without recurring royalties or payments. Nevertheless, it's crucial to comprehend that "royalty-free" doesn't constantly equate to "free." Some royalty-free tracks need an upfront payment, while others are entirely free for both personal and business use.

The crucial advantage of royalty-free music is its versatility. Unlike conventional certified music, which requires payment each time a track is utilized, royalty-free music permits developers to pay as soon as-- or not at all-- and utilize the track across a wide array of platforms and content types.

The Growing Need for No Copyright Music

In the digital age, platforms like YouTube, Instagram, and TikTok have rigid copyright policies, mostly created to secure the rights of initial material developers. Nevertheless, this frequently leaves video creators vulnerable to having their material flagged or perhaps gotten rid of if they unintentionally use copyrighted music. YouTube, for example, uses a sophisticated Content ID system that can immediately find copyrighted product and limit or generate income from content accordingly. For creators relying on these platforms for income, copyright strikes can result in demonetization, which indicates no ad revenue from their videos.

This is where no copyright music comes in as an option. Copyright-free or royalty-free tracks permit developers to use music in their projects without dealing with copyright claims. These tracks are clearly certified for public use and normally readily available in audio libraries throughout the web. Utilizing copyright-free background music allows content creators to lawfully integrate audio into their work, giving them assurance that they won't encounter legal problem.

Where to Find the Best No Copyright Music

There are learn more several platforms that use comprehensive libraries of royalty-free music. Some of the most popular sources consist of:

Pixabay is known for its vast collection of free stock music. With over 30,000 music tracks readily available for download, the platform uses music throughout a wide variety of genres and moods, from relaxing ambient music to high-energy electronic tracks. Pixabay is specifically appealing to YouTube creators due to the fact that the music is free for business use and does smooth jazz not require attribution.

Bensound is another popular choice for developers trying to find top quality royalty-free music. It offers a variety of genres, from cinematic and orchestral pieces to positive, corporate background music. While Bensound does require attribution for free tracks, developers can also acquire licenses for more comprehensive usage without needing to credit the artist.

Popular Genres in Royalty-Free Music

Royalty-free music is available throughout essentially every category, providing creators the flexibility to pick tracks that fit their job's tone, style, and audience. Some popular categories consist of:

Corporate and Motivational Music: These tracks are typically used in business presentations, explainer videos, and business training products. They tend to be positive, inspiring, and created to stimulate the audience.

Lo-fi and Chill: Lo-fi beats are popular in vlogs and live streams, particularly those focused around way of life, study, or relaxation. Their laid-back vibe is ideal for producing a calm, focused environment.

Electronic and EDM: Electronic music is ideal for hectic content like gaming videos, tech evaluations, or energetic item launches. These high-energy tracks keep the audience engaged and excited.

Cinematic and Orchestral: This category works well in films, trailers, and significant content. The grand, sweeping tones of cinematic music aid develop a sense of wonder, tension, or enjoyment, making it popular for high-impact visuals.

Ambient and Relaxing: Ambient music is typically utilized in meditation, yoga, or wellness material. Its slow tempo and soft instrumentation create a serene environment that enhances the relaxation experience for audiences.

Finest Practices When Using Royalty-Free Music

When using royalty-free music, it's important to guarantee that you're adhering to the licensing contracts related to the tracks. While royalty-free music is devoid of continuous payments, some tracks may need attribution to the artist or author. Constantly examine the regards to the license and offer proper credit when necessary.

It's likewise crucial to choose music that matches your content. For instance, using fast, high-energy music in a slow-paced tutorial might seem out of place and sidetrack viewers from the material.
